Huijun He is a scholar working on Molecular Biology, Epidemiology and Pharmacology. According to data from OpenAlex, Huijun He has authored 12 papers receiving a total of 333 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 2 papers in Epidemiology and 2 papers in Pharmacology. Recurrent topics in Huijun He’s work include Renal and related cancers (3 papers), TGF-β signaling in diseases (2 papers) and Heat shock proteins research (1 paper). Huijun He is often cited by papers focused on Renal and related cancers (3 papers), TGF-β signaling in diseases (2 papers) and Heat shock proteins research (1 paper). Huijun He collaborates with scholars based in China, Hong Kong and Canada. Huijun He's co-authors include Hui Y. Lan, Honglian Wang, Xiaocui Chen and Ruizhi Tan and has published in prestigious journals such as Nature Communications, Diabetes and International Journal of Molecular Sciences.
